The chapter opens with a sharp clash of wills. Autumn, ever composed and unyielding, finds herself face-to-face with Simon – a man whose presence is as unwelcome as a storm cloud on a sunny day. He barges in without invitation, and Autumn, with a voice laced with steel, does not hold back. "Mr. Lewis, if memory serves me right, I never extended an invitation for a discussion." Her words are a scalpel, cutting through any pretense of civility. The message is clear: you are not welcome here.
Simon, however, is not one to leave quietly. He responds with a cold, dismissive snort, leaving behind a threat that hangs in the air like poison: "Autumn, mark my words, you will come to regret your actions today." The door slams shut with such force that it seems to shake the room to its core. Autumn lets out a weary sigh, feeling the weight of his malice settle on her shoulders. But she is no stranger to adversity. With a sip of water, she washes away the bitterness and steadies herself for what lies ahead.
The day of the expo dawns, vibrant and alive. Autumn steps into the venue alongside Ethan, and the atmosphere is electric – buzzing with anticipation, eager chatter, and the promise of something new. In the past, Autumn kept her distance at such events, preferring to navigate the crowd alone. But today, she walks by Ethan's side, a quiet but powerful statement of unity.
As soon as Ethan crosses the threshold, he is swarmed. Attendees press in, their eyes bright with curiosity. "Mr. Sharp, we've heard whispers that Vanguard is on the brink of unveiling a groundbreaking new project!" one man exclaims. Others chime in, recalling the AI diagnostic system that shook the industry four years ago – a system that had even been integrated at the national level. The praise is effusive, the expectations sky-high. "If anyone can win this bid, it has to be Vanguard," they say, almost as if it's already decided.
Ethan offers a courteous smile, but he can feel the weight of their assumptions pressing down on him. He gently deflects, reminding them that in a bidding war, nothing is guaranteed. Then, with deliberate care, he adds: "And let's not forget – that AI diagnostic system wasn't solely my creation. It was the brilliant work of a junior colleague."
The words drop like a stone into still water. Ripples of shock spread through the crowd. A middle-aged man raises an eyebrow, disbelief etched across his face. "Mr. Sharp, are you being serious?"
What follows is a moment of profound revelation – and profound skepticism. The attendees have always assumed that the genius behind the revolutionary medical AI was either older or at least a prodigy like Ethan himself. But the idea that a young woman – barely in her early twenties, someone they've never heard of – could be the mastermind? It seems impossible to them.
Their disbelief is almost palpable. A young man with glasses scoffs. "Mr. Sharp, surely you jest. Your talents are already at the pinnacle of this industry. Even if your junior colleague possesses remarkable skills, she's just a girl in her early twenties. How could she possibly eclipse your accomplishments?" The question hangs in the air, heavy with bias and underestimation.
Ethan, however, stands firm. He knows Autumn deeply – knows that she is driven not by recognition, but by results. She wants to prove her worth through tangible achievements, to silence the doubters with nothing but sheer determination. And as for the mockery and derision she has faced? She has never wasted her energy on their opinions.
But the crowd's reaction exposes the ugly undercurrent of the industry: a place where youth and female talent are often dismissed, where the brilliance of a woman is met with skepticism instead of awe. Yet, despite their doubt, Autumn's genius looms large – and Ethan's defense of her shines as a testament to the challenges they both face in a world that so often overlooks the quiet power of women.
